How to handle information management as a GM. Basically "Landmark, Hidden, Secret" by @diyanddragons.bsky.social
(diyanddragons.blogspot.com/2019/10/land...)
Abolish perception checks. Just give the players information based on their queries and fictional position.

Yeah, "weird lil guy" came up in an early episode of B2C. Brad had said something like every dungeon should have a freaky lil guy who lives there and loves it for players to interact with.
It's definitely become a meme since then. But it's also great advice.
